ACTIVITIES:
  • Collect, load data from various sources and create a datastore for every project
  • Convert, transform, spatialize data from several types and sources
  • Import and export data (GIS, well, seismic and log data..) from multiple sources and multiple formats.
  • Organize and structure projects folders (structure, standardization, cataloging…)
  • Maintain and update corporate data base and organize technical documents
  • Manage subsurface and GIS data using ArcGIS/Petrel/SISMAGE
  • Transfer data between Petrel/SISMAGE/ArcGIS
  • Create maps (log maps, pies on maps ….) and GIS analysis, create and maintain a Web GIS
  • Provide and synthesize geological reports, charts (Well Charts with shows, reservoirs etc…) and figures
  • Search and extract data from technical reports (stratigraphy, reservoir intervals, Source Rock intervals, shows …)
  • Automate routine tasks using python scripts or data processing workflows
  • Create and maintain data analysis and visualization dashboards using Power BI and MS Excel
  • Interact with different data sources using SQL queries, in house and market search tools…
  • Develop and/or prepare presentation materials (graphics, charts, illustration, tables, figures…..
  • Update and maintains SharePoint website
